BLOOMINGTON,Ind. — February 26, 2026
A 74-year-old Bloomington woman was killed and three other people, including a child, were injured in a three-vehicle crash Wednesday evening on South Rockport Road, according to the Monroe County Sheriff’s Office.
Deputies were called at about 6:16 p.m. Feb. 25, 2026, to a report of a traffic crash with injuries near S. Rockport Road at W. Stansifer Court. Preliminary evidence indicates a northbound Subaru crossed left of center into the southbound lane and collided head-on with a Kia, the sheriff’s office said. A third vehicle, a Toyota, then became involved.
The Kia’s driver, a 74-year-old Bloomington woman, was pronounced dead at the scene, officials said.
The Subaru’s driver, a 48-year-old Bloomington man, was taken to the hospital with injuries. A 7-year-old child who was a passenger in the Subaru was also transported to the hospital with serious injuries, the sheriff’s office said.
The Toyota’s driver, a 58-year-old Bloomington man, was transported to the hospital with minor injuries, according to authorities.
Investigators with the Monroe County Major Crash Investigation Team responded, and the roadway was closed for several hours while reconstruction work was conducted. The investigation remains ongoing, and additional details will be released when they are available, the sheriff’s office said.
